Marcin Majewski wrote:
What means "Q" in QC8087-2 ?

Here is a full list of prefixes - in case if it's needed:

A - automotive operating temperature range
I - Industrial grade
L - extended temperature range with burn-in
Q - commercial temperature range with burn-in
T - exended temperature range without burn-in
